Comprehensive quality detection method for tomatoes combining machine vision and spectral techniques
ObjectiveTo realize rapid and accurate measurement of both internal and external quality of tomatoes, and improve the efficiency and quality of tomato grading.MethodsBased on machine vision and spectroscopy technology, proposed a tomato comprehensive quality grading method which combined external an...
